Berry Cheesecake

  1. Preheat the oven to 325u0b0F. Lightly grease a 9-inch springform pan. Line bottom and side with parchment paper.
  2. Process cookies in a food processor until finely crushed. Add butter and cinnamon. Process to combine. Press mixture firmly and evenly into bottom of prepared pan. Refrigerate for 20 mins.
  3. Beat cream cheese and sugar in a large bowl with electric mixer until smooth.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Add 1 1/4 cups of the cream and liqueur, beating until smooth. Fold in berries. Pour mixture over cookie crust, smoothing surface.
  4. Bake 45-50 mins, until just set and slightly wobbly in center. Turn oven off and allow cheesecake to cool with door ajar for 1 hour. Cover and refrigerate overnight.
  5. Whip remaining 1 1/4 cups cream to soft peaks. Spoon over top of cheesecake and pile with fresh berries. Dust with powdered sugar to serve.

cookies, unsalted butter, ground cinnamon, cream cheese, sugar, eggs, heavy cream, raspberries, mixed berries, powdered sugar
